MEASURE THE WINDOW. CLEAN THE WINDOW. CUT THE FILM. REMOVE THE CLEAR FILM BACKING (“the liner”) PLACE THE FILM ON THE WET WINDOW. SPRAY THE OUTSIDE SURFACE OF THE FILM AND SQUEEGEE FILM CAREFULLY AND FIRMLY. TRIM EDGES OF FILM AND SQUEEGEE DRY.
Spray the inside (filmed) surface of the window thoroughly with removal solution. Avoid breathing rising fumes. Immediately lay up your pre-cut black plastic sheet onto the wet inside surface of the glass. Position it carefully to cover all exposed film, smoothing out any large air pockets with the palm of your hand.
